No, Marvel isn't trying to do away with the X-Men. And they certainly aren't replacing them with Inhumans, since that show is getting terrible reviews and ratings are lousy. It'll more than likely get cancelled. The deal is that 20th Century Fox owns the film rights to all X-Men properties because Marvel sold the X-Men and Fantastic Four to Fox and Spider-Man to Sony during their bankruptcy in the 1990's. Now, Marvel made a deal with Sony to let Spider-Man in the MCU with the Avengers, but the X-Men are still squarely in their own separate universe over at Fox. Universal still has The Hulk, which is why Marvel hasn't made any more solo Hulk movies and why he only appears in other characters' movies.

The only X-characters that Marvel is allowed to use are Quicksilver and Scarlet Witch, whom they share with Fox, because even though they were introduced in the X-Men comics they've been featured in The Avengers comics far longer. That's why there have been two different Quicksilvers in the movies - Evan Peters in the X-Men films and Aaron Taylor Johnson in The Avengers films. The X-Men films can't make any references to their storyline in the Avengers, and as yet haven't used Scarlet Witch. The Avengers films can't use the term "mutant" or refer to them as mutants or as Magneto's children, so they were changed to bio-engineered super-humans. I'm not quite sure about who has the TV rights, but Fox is clearly developing all the TV shows like The Gifted and Legion.

Now, Marvel did cancel Fantastic Four comics, probably to stick it to Fox, but also because that comic hasn't been selling well lately. It was once the flagship of Marvel Comics, but has sadly fallen from its former popularity. X-Men comics are still being published, but Marvel has forbade its writers from creating any new X-Men characters, knowing that their film rights would automatically end up being owned by Fox.
